Greece - Import of Woven Fabric of Polyester Staple Fibres, Mixed Mainly or Solely with Man-Made Filaments

Since 2014, Greece Import of Woven Fabric of Polyester Staple Fibres, Mixed Mainly or Solely with Man-Made Filaments was down by 10.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 47 among other countries in Import of Woven Fabric of Polyester Staple Fibres, Mixed Mainly or Solely with Man-Made Filaments with $1,653,452.25. Greece is overtaken by Paraguay, which was number 46 at $1,834,317 and is followed by Russia at $1,491,531.87. United States lead the ranking with $42,643,530.98 in 2019, that is +1.1% compared to 2018. Indonesia, Mexico and South Korea resp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Albania witnessed the best average annual growth at +159.3% per year, while Benin was the worst growing country at -68.8% per year.
